What Is Ethnic Rhinoplasty?
The Art of Non-Westernized Nasal Refinement
Unlike traditional nose jobs that historically aimed for a singular, Western aesthetic standard, modern Ethnic Nose Surgery is tailored for patients of diverse backgrounds—including South Asian, Middle Eastern, East Asian, and African descents.
The primary medical and structural goals include:
- Facial Proportion Mapping: Aligning the nose with the unique angles of your cheekbones, lips, and chin.
- Preserving Heritage: Refining the nasal contours without erasing the distinctive traits of your lineage.
- Structural Augmentation: Building up a low bridge or weak tip using natural tissue rather than rigid synthetic implants.
- Airway Optimization: Correcting deep-seated internal blockages while altering the external shape.

Structural Challenges Addressed in Ethnic Nose Surgery
- Broad Nasal Bridge: Osteotomy & Narrowing Without Airway Pinching
- Wide/Bulbous Tip: Interdomal Suturing & Cartilage Defatting
- Flared Nostrils:Alar Base Reduction / Wee Excisions
- Thick Dermal Cover: Specialized Structural Grafting for Definition
1. Management of Thick Nasal Skin
Many ethnic patients possess a thick, sebaceous skin envelope with dense fibrofatty tissue. Traditional thinning techniques can cause internal scarring. Our team utilizes advanced structural grafting to provide a strong framework that pushes through the thick skin to create crisp, clear definition.
2. Refining a Broad Nasal Bridge
To narrow a wide bridge, we perform precise, controlled micro-osteotomies. This brings the nasal bones closer together at the midline without compromising the internal nasal vault or restricting airflow.
3. Septorhinoplasty (Comprehensive Form & Function)
Instead of aggressively removing cartilage—which leads to structural collapse—we reshape the existing tip using advanced suture techniques and structural support grafts (like septal extension grafts) to achieve a natural, permanent lift.
4. Alar Base Reduction (Fixing Flared Nostrils)
Reducing wide nostrils requires extreme artistic precision. We place incisions discreetly within the natural creases where the nostril meets the cheek (the alar-facial groove), ensuring the resulting markers are completely hidden from view.
Why This Procedure Requires Specialized ENT Expertise
An ethnic nose cannot be treated with standard cosmetic methods. The internal anatomy requires a deep understanding of varied structural differences:
- Cartilage Properties: Ethnic nasal cartilage is often softer, thinner, or less abundant, requiring specialized reinforcing techniques.
- Airway Dynamics: A wider nasal base alters how air flows through the turbinates and valves. An ENT-led team ensures that narrowing the base never causes post-surgery breathing difficulties.
- Grafting Requirements: Achieving definition often requires sourcing secondary structural materials, such as the patient's own ear or rib cartilage, to safely build up the bridge.
The Surgical Approaches: Open vs. Closed
During your clinical evaluation at Microcare, we select the incision strategy based on your structural requirements:
Closed Ethnic Rhinoplasty (Endonasal)
- How it works: All incisions are made inside the nostrils.
- Best for: Minor bridge leveling or minimal tip work.
- Benefit: Complete absence of external scarring and slightly faster initial recovery.
Open Ethnic Rhinoplasty (External)
- How it works: A tiny, microscopic inverted-V incision is made across the columella.
- Best for: Complex structural rebuilding, tip reshaping, and revision cases.
- Benefit: Provides the surgeon with direct visualization to place structural grafts with sub-millimeter precision.
Real Time Recovery & Healing Milestones
Because ethnic skin contains more collagen and a thicker dermal layer, the healing timeline progresses in distinct, steady phases:
- Days 1–7 (The Splint Period): An external splint protects the new framework. Mild swelling around the mid-face is normal. The splint is removed on Day 7 at our hospital.
- Weeks 2–3 (The Social Return): Bruising fades. Most patients return to work or university, looking socially presentable.
- Months 1–3 (The Contouring Phase): The initial "thick" swelling drops, and the new bridge height begins to show its final shape.
- Months 6–12+ (Final Definition): The thick skin envelope fully adapts to the new underlying architecture. Due to skin thickness, refined definition continues to improve for up to 18 months.

1. High-Definition Diagnostic Nasal Endoscopy
Before planning any cosmetic refinement, we pass a microscopic, illuminated fiber-optic lens into the nasal passages. This allows our ENT specialists to visualize your internal nasal valves, septum, and turbinates on a digital monitor. We identify hidden structural causes of mouth breathing and sinus blocks, ensuring they are corrected alongside your cosmetic enhancements.
2. Precision Multi-Planar CT Imaging
For complex reconstructions and revision surgeries, we utilize low-radiation nasal CT scans. This technology gives our surgical team a three-dimensional view of your nasal bones and internal cartilage density. Knowing your exact internal anatomy beforehand allows us to plan graft placement down to the millimeter, shortening your time under anesthesia.
3. Craniofacial Proportionality Assessment
We use advanced digital mapping to analyze your unique facial architecture. Rather than comparing your features to standard Western templates, our software measures the specific relationships between your eyes, forehead, lips, and jaw. This scientific analysis guides our surgeons in determining the exact bridge height and tip angle required to enhance your natural facial harmony while preserving your ethnic authenticity.

1. Will surgical incisions cause noticeable scarring or keloids on darker skin tones?
Skin types common in South Asian, Middle Eastern, and African ethnicities have a higher density of melanin and a more active fibroblastic response, which requires specialized care to prevent raised scars or keloids.
At Microcare ENT Hospital, we minimize this risk by placing incisions within the natural anatomical shadows of the nose, such as the alar-facial groove or the narrowest part of the columella. We use microscopic, ultra-fine suturing techniques to ensure tension-free closure.
Following surgery, our team provides a specialized post-operative dermatological protocol—including medical-grade silicone gels and strict UV protection advice—to ensure incisions heal smoothly and fade into your natural skin tone.
2.Where does the cartilage graft come from if my septum is too weak or small?
Many ethnic nasal profiles feature a small or thin septum, meaning there may not be enough internal cartilage available to build up a flat bridge or support a thick tip. In these cases, our surgeons safely harvest autologous cartilage from secondary areas:
- Conchal (Ear) Cartilage: Ideal for shaping and softening the nasal tip. It is harvested through a discreet incision behind the ear that leaves no visible change to your ear’s shape.
- Costal (Rib) Cartilage: The gold standard for significant bridge augmentation and complex revision cases. It provides a strong, abundant volume of living tissue that integrates perfectly, eliminating the risks of rejection or infection associated with synthetic silicone implants.
